Meeting and Pickup Information
Passengers embarking on the Patagonia adventure will find the meeting and pickup information vital for a smooth transition from the airport to their destination in El Calafate. When it comes to pickup logistics, travelers can choose a pickup point and should confirm the start time with the local provider in advance. The service operates from 5/1/2020 to 3/14/2025, between 07:00 AM and 10:00 PM. The drop-off point is El Calafate, Province of Santa Cruz, Patagonia. A guide will be waiting at the airport for pickup, and hotel pickup is arranged for departure.

Expectations and Restrictions
Travelers should note that this transportation service isn’t wheelchair accessible. When booking this shuttle service for their Patagonia adventure, here are a few key points to keep in mind:
- Infant Seating: Infants must be seated on laps during the journey.
- Maximum Travelers: The shuttle can accommodate a maximum of 15 travelers per trip.
- Duration Varies: The duration of the trip may vary depending on traffic conditions.

Cancellation Policy Details
For a hassle-free booking experience, travelers can cancel their airport shuttle service for their Patagonia adventure up to 24 hours in advance to receive a full refund. The refund process is straightforward, ensuring peace of mind for those planning their trip.
However, it’s important to note that there are cancellation exceptions to be aware of. In case of cancellations made less than 24 hours before the start time, no refund will be issued, and changes aren’t accepted within this timeframe. Travelers should keep these cut-off times in mind, as they’re based on the local time zone.
